Image denoising via K-SVD with primal-dual active set algorithm

01/19/2020
by   Quan Xiao, et al.
24

K-SVD algorithm has been successfully applied to image denoising tasks dozens of years but the big bottleneck in speed and accuracy still needs attention to break. For the sparse coding stage in K-SVD, which involves ℓ_0 constraint, prevailing methods usually seek approximate solutions greedily but are less effective once the noise level is high. The alternative ℓ_1 optimization is proved to be powerful than ℓ_0, however, the time consumption prevents it from the implementation. In this paper, we propose a new K-SVD framework called K-SVD_P by applying the Primal-dual active set (PDAS) algorithm to it. Different from the greedy algorithms based K-SVD, the K-SVD_P algorithm develops a selection strategy motivated by KKT (Karush-Kuhn-Tucker) condition and yields to an efficient update in the sparse coding stage. Since the K-SVD_P algorithm seeks for an equivalent solution to the dual problem iteratively with simple explicit expression in this denoising problem, speed and quality of denoising can be reached simultaneously. Experiments are carried out and demonstrate the comparable denoising performance of our K-SVD_P with state-of-the-art methods.

READ FULL TEXT

page 2

page 7

page 8

research
02/22/2015

Boosting of Image Denoising Algorithms

In this paper we propose a generic recursive algorithm for improving ima...
research
09/28/2019

Deep K-SVD Denoising

This work considers noise removal from images, focusing on the well know...
research
07/11/2018

A Trilateral Weighted Sparse Coding Scheme for Real-World Image Denoising

Most of existing image denoising methods assume the corrupted noise to b...
research
01/02/2020

First image then video: A two-stage network for spatiotemporal video denoising

Video denoising is to remove noise from noise-corrupted data, thus recov...
research
06/26/2018

Multimodal Image Denoising based on Coupled Dictionary Learning

In this paper, we propose a new multimodal image denoising approach to a...
research
03/01/2023

Cloud K-SVD for Image Denoising

Cloud K-SVD is a dictionary learning algorithm that can train at multipl...
research
06/08/2020

tfShearlab: The TensorFlow Digital Shearlet Transform for Deep Learning

The shearlet transform from applied harmonic analysis is currently the s...

Please sign up or login with your details

Forgot password? Click here to reset